What all pre-op tests did your surgeon have you do?
I am a revision and had a upper GI and endoscopy in the fall leading up to my revision. To prep for surgery I had to do a full panel of bloodwork/labs (about 12 vials), 24 hour urine, EKG, spirometry, upper chest x ray, and abdominal ultrasound. My surgeon is very thorough and doesn't want any surprises going into surgery.

My doctor required a chest X-ray, ekg, blood tests, fecal test, psychological eval, nutritionist , doing a 1,200 calorie a day diet, and. exercise at least 3 days a week.
My understanding is also just before surgery we will again be required to do another
order of blood tests and fecal test, and then be cleared for surgery by our primary care
physician. If the surgeon wants additional tests they will be ordered when we meet
with him just before the actual surgery.

Let me see....Chest Xray, blood work, sleep study, pulmonary function test, EKG, psych. eval, Phys. Therapist, Nutritionist, Multiple group meetings regarding Pre-op, Post-op, preparing for surgery, what to expect in the hospital on the day of and days following surgery etc. I also had to take a test to make sure I fully understood the surgery and what to expect afterwards. I also had to sign an agreement promising to follow guidelines and make sure I allend all my post op appts. I feel like they did their part to make sure I was prepared for every aspect of this surgery.
